当前位置:  开发笔记 > 前端 > 正文

Safari中的HTML5日期字段和占位符文本

如何解决《Safari中的HTML5日期字段和占位符文本》经验,为你挑选了2个好方法。

我有一个问题,但我不确定这是不是我做错了,或者这个功能是否还不支持.

基本上我有以下几行代码:




我已经在桌面版Safari上测试了这一点并且一切都很好,但是当我在iPad上测试它时,第二个输入不会显示占位符文本.有谁知道iPad上的type ="date"是否支持占位符文字?

干杯尼克



1> robertc..:

iPad正在做正确的事情.类型上的元素不支持该placeholder属性.它可能在桌面Safari上工作,因为它不支持该类型,因此该属性被忽略并且您留下了纯文本字段.您可以检查DOM检查器.inputdatedate


但是,如果您使用占位符作为标签,某些移动布局就是这种情况呢?那就变成了烦恼.
干杯.感谢您获得优质资源的链接!已预订以供日后使用.必须说这有点奇怪,你可以在一些文本字段上有占位符文本,而不是其他文本字段.如果我想将格式添加为占位符(例如'dd/mm/yy'),该怎么办?

2> sidarcy..:

这里有一点点hack ...

最初将字段作为文本字段。当用户将重点放在字段上时,切换字段类型为日期并重新对焦。

在ios6中测试

的HTML


JS


推荐阅读
135369一生真爱_890
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有